Session Recordings and Transcripts
Sessions are not recorded or transcribed without your knowledge.
Where recording or transcription is proposed, I will explain:
What is being recorded or transcribed.
Why it is being created.
Which service or technology will be used.
How the resulting material may be used and stored.
Whether an AI-assisted service is involved.
How long the material is expected to be retained.
Express consent will be obtained before a sensitive session is recorded or transcribed. You may ask questions or decline before the recording begins.

AI-Assisted Tools
My work has always involved listening closely, documenting what I perceive and finding language for information that may not initially arrive in words.
My writing and practice are informed by more than forty years of psychic mediumship and Intuitive Integration, along with CranioSacral Therapy, SomatoEmotional Release, neuroacoustic practice, Five Element work, natural healing, archetypal and symbolic inquiry, metaphysics, esoterica, traditional oracles and Usui-Do.
I may use AI-assisted tools to:
Capture spoken or fast-moving material.
Organize notes and transcripts.
Trace patterns through complex material.
Support research.
Test structure and clarity.
Assist with editing and administrative work.
AI does not conduct my readings, receive information from Source Intelligence, determine what psychic material means or replace my discernment and professional judgment.
I do not use AI to make automated decisions about whether someone may work with me, what they should do, what an experience means or what outcome they should pursue.
I will not place a complete, directly identifiable client transcript or sensitive client record into a general-purpose AI system. Where AI-assisted tools are used, I limit the material to what is reasonably needed and remove or reduce identifying information wherever practicable.
I review, question, and revise everything that carries my name. The lived experience, psychic perception, interpretation, selection, final language, authorship and responsibility remain mine.

Booking and Practice Terms
Booking, Rescheduling and Cancellations
Appointment time is reserved specifically for you.
For private sessions and package sessions, at least 48 hours’ notice is required to cancel or reschedule.
For Discovery Calls, at least two business days’ notice is required.
Late cancellations and missed appointments may be considered forfeited and may not be rescheduled or credited, except at my discretion or where otherwise agreed.
If I need to cancel, or if a technical issue on my end prevents the session from proceeding, the appointment will be rescheduled without penalty.
Late Arrivals and No-Shows
Sessions begin and end at the scheduled times.
For regular sessions, a delay of up to 10 minutes may sometimes be accommodated, but the session will still end at the original time. A longer delay may require rescheduling or may be treated as a missed appointment.
Brief delays for Discovery Calls may be accommodated, but the call will still end at the scheduled time. Longer delays may require rescheduling.
Payments and Refunds
Payment reserves time and supports the preparation, administration and care involved in the work.
Except where required by law or agreed in writing, completed sessions, used services, digital resources and package payments are generally non-refundable.
If you have a serious concern immediately after the first paid session in a package, contact me in writing within 24 hours and explain it clearly. I will review the circumstances in good faith. This does not guarantee a refund.
Unused package sessions, payment plans, cancellations and transfers are governed by the written agreement connected with the particular service.
Complimentary Discovery Calls do not involve a payment or refund.
